Hyundai Mobis gets 7,500+ mobility patents in 3 Years

According to a recent announcement from Hyundai Mobis, it has received over 7,500 patents during the previous three years, greatly increasing its global competitiveness.

The numbers were made public during the company’s yearly Invention Day celebration, which took place at its research facility in Yongin, which is located just south of Seoul.The Hyundai Motor Group’s auto parts division reports that over 3,000 of these patents relate to technologies in electrification, autonomous driving, and connected vehicles.

In the past year, of the 2,300 new patents filed by Hyundai Mobis, over 1,000 centered on future mobility technologies. High-definition heads-up displays and sophisticated smart key technology that guards against digital key hacking are among the important patents that have been registered. Hyundai Mobis places a strong emphasis on the environment in which internal inventors and patent specialists collaborate. To safeguard its intellectual property in each of these important overseas markets—North America, Europe, and India—the corporation also collaborates with patent agents.
